Best practices & tips to get maximum value

  • Standardize your chart of accounts mapping on the mapping sheet before the first run — saves time month to month.
  • Keep a copy of raw GL extracts and use the template’s import tools or the “raw-data” sheet to maintain an audit trail.
  • Enable macros only if you trust the file source; use digital signatures for shared automation workflows.
  • Use the validation summary to fix flagged items before finalizing the report — it reduces auditor questions.
  • Schedule ProXlsx hourly support during your first two month-ends to ensure the template fits your processes.

Common mistakes when buying/using similar templates — and how to avoid them

  • Buying a generic template: Fails when regulatory categories don’t match. Avoid by using a bank-specific template with mapping sheets.
  • Ignoring reconciliation: Leads to unexplained variances. Use the template’s reconciliation checks and tie lines back to GL.
  • Over-automating prematurely: Complex macros without standard input formats break when data changes. Start with the Standard version and add automation after stabilizing inputs.
  • Poor change control: Multiple edited copies create version confusion. Keep one master and use “Save as” for archives; consider adding a version sheet.
